Gardner Denver is proud to announce that they are combining with Ingersoll Rand’s Industrial segment to create a global leader in mission-critical flow creation and industrial technologies. This transformational transaction brings together two highly complementary, premium companies with strong operating platforms and a combined 300+ year history of operational excellence, innovation and quality. Together, we will offer more comprehensive solutions and a broader industry-leading product, service and aftermarket portfolio. The new company will be led by Gardner Denver CEO Vicente Reynal and is expected to be called Ingersoll Rand.
